Where to Get Pallets For used pallets for sale Free

If you see pallets lined up or leaning against a storefront, don't believe they're for sale. Many small businesses, such as gas stations, grocery stores with stores attached, pet stores and hardware stores regularly receive shipments on pallets.

Ask employees whether they have any items that don't meet their quality standards or aren't being utilized. You might be able to receive them for free or for a low cost.

When looking for pallets, you should check their markings and stamps. Pallets that are stamped with MB (Methyl Bromide) should be avoided since they've been treated with chemicals that could harm the wood used in your project. Pallets with SF are heat-treated and safe to reuse. You can also contact local recycling centers to find out whether they have pallets that are not being used or have been recovered from the garbage. This is a good alternative to checking online marketplaces because you'll often get a better deal by speaking directly to the recyclers.

Grocery Stores

Wood pallets are a popular DIY material, thanks to the low cost and versatility of this material. However, finding pallets can be a challenge particularly for those who want to avoid paying expensive shipping costs. There are a variety of ways to locate free pallets of wood for your next project.

One of the best places to search for buy pallets uk​ is the local supermarket, according to Money Pantry. Grocery stores receive large shipments every day, and typically have extras. You might find that smaller, independent grocery stores are more willing to work together than large chains. Pallets that were packed with grain or other dry goods, rather than food products, can be the best quality. Pallets that were in contact with food are more likely to be stained and spills, which can lead to mold and other unpleasant adverse effects.

Bars are another pallets source as they receive a lot of wine, beer, and liquor on a regular basis. If you're able to swing by during slower afternoon hours, they might be more than willing to offer their pallets for your use.

Remember that taking a pallet out of a retail location without permission is considered to be theft and should be avoided at all costs. Instead, explain your intentions to the manager or warehouse staff. You could tell them you want to use the pallets as a garden bed, or even an abode for chickens. Don't be afraid to ask local businesses and builders for their willingness to donate pallets.

Manufacturing Plants

Industrial facilities require pallets that are strong and durable. They can't break under the pressure of heavy loads. Factory pallets are also referred to as storage or racking pallets. They come in metal, wood, and plastic models. The materials used will depend on the kind of product that is being transported or stored as well as temperatures, storage and transport conditions. The selection of the appropriate pallet buying​ for the job requires expert advice from a pallet company that has an experienced team of experts in the industry.

Pallets are typically left in distribution centers and warehouses after the palletized items were received. They could have been damaged during transport, or they could be too small for their needs or are not in the right condition to meet their business's pallet standards. They might be discarded at the warehouse or left outside, where they can cause tripping hazards. Some businesses are able to reuse their pallets, and others discard them after a single use, or discover that it's easier to pay for recycling services to remove them.

If you are looking for wood pallets that are free to use for your DIY projects, call local manufacturing companies and ask whether they have pallets available. They may be willing to put aside pallets that don't meet their standards or have minor damage, in the event that they know you'll use them for your own home projects. You can also ask whether they know of a recycling business that is interested in purchasing them.
